This young woman's experience exists at the heart of the Salem Witch Trials. And while we will likely never know Tituba's true intentions or motivations, we do know that she confessed. In part 2, we will read HER words and see how the magistrates pushed her to tell a perfect tale. Join your favorite Salem tour guides as they discuss Tituba Indian's role in 1692, what we know of her fate, and how she's treated by history in the centuries to follow.
